26 lines
810 B
Markdown
26 lines
810 B
Markdown
|
# Sum Of Multiples
|
||
|
|
||
|
Write a program that, given a number, can find the sum of all the multiples of particular numbers up to but not including that number.
|
||
|
|
||
|
If we list all the natural numbers up to but not including 15 that are
|
||
|
multiples of either 3 or 5, we get 3, 5, 6 and 9, 10, and 12.
|
||
|
|
||
|
The sum of these multiples is 45.
|
||
|
|
||
|
Write a program that can find the sum of the multiples of a given set of
|
||
|
numbers.
|
||
|
|
||
|
To run the tests simply run the command `go test` in the exercise directory.
|
||
|
|
||
|
If the test suite contains benchmarks, you can run these with the `-bench`
|
||
|
flag:
|
||
|
|
||
|
go test -bench .
|
||
|
|
||
|
For more detailed info about the Go track see the [help
|
||
|
page](http://help.exercism.io/getting-started-with-go.html).
|
||
|
|
||
|
## Source
|
||
|
|
||
|
A variation on Problem 1 at Project Euler [view source](http://projecteuler.net/problem=1)
|